Despite the blog slacking, we have a lot going on. We're gearing up for the CMJ Music Marathon 2009! Our showcase is on Wednesday, October 21st at the Alphabet Lounge (Avenue C and E. 7th Street) at 10pm. Here's the schedule for the night:
7pm - Heath Street
8pm - Jones Street Station
9pm - Blair
10pm - Bel Air
Notice anything about this list? Two "street" bands and then Blair and Bel Air. The CMJ schedulers have an interesting sense of humor. When Wyatt was in Masculine Feminine he played a CMJ showcase with Junior Senior and Mommy and Daddy.
The weird thing about this bill is that it actually makes sense. Heath Street is folkie singer/songwriter kind of stuff, Jones Street Station (who didn't get to play at last year's ill-fated pig roast) are great country rock featuring our friend Jon Hull on harmonica. Blair's songs are really interesting - influenced by Neil Young and alt-country but not in an obvious way. Then us. You know what we sound like: kind of an amalgamation of all of the above.
